The Importance of Personal Privacy in the Digital Age

The concept of personal privacy is more relevant than ever as we spend increasing amounts of time online. It pertains to an individual's ability to control, determine, and dictate when, how, and for what purposes their personal information is handled by others. Ensuring personal privacy is crucial to human dignity, safety, and self-determination, allowing individuals to develop their unique personalities without fear of unwanted intrusion.

Data Privacy Regulations

As a result of these concerns, there has been a demand for data privacy regulations to ensure transparency and give individuals control over their data. Laws such as the EU's General Data Protection Regulation (GDPR) and the California Consumer Privacy Act (CCPA) have made it necessary for companies to obtain consent before collecting and processing personal data. Compliance with these regulations is not optional; organizations must adapt to protect the privacy of their users.
